Q: Is 8,581,060 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 8,581,060 is not a prime number.

Why is 8,581,060 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 8581060 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 10 20 71 142 284 355 710 1,420 6,043 12,086 24,172 30,215 60,430 120,860 429,053 858,106 1,716,212 2,145,265 4,290,530 and 8,581,060, with no remainder.

Since 8,581,060 cannot be divided by just 1 and 8,581,060, it is not a prime number.
